April 1, 1964: Redskins Begin to See Sonny Days | Redskin Historian
On April 1, 1964, the Redskins made one of the greatest trades in team history, dealing quarterback Norm Snead in exchange for Eagles QB Sonny Jurgensen. The great No. 9 played his last 11 seasons in D.C., solidifying his spot as one of the best pure passers to ever play the game.
